Cognitive skills development in children aged 5-7 is crucial as this period serves as a foundation for lifelong learning. During these formative years, children experience rapid brain development, shaping their ability to think, learn, and process information. Parents and teachers should prioritize cognitive skill development because it directly influences a child’s academic success, social skills, and emotional well-being.

Strengthening cognitive skills, such as memory, attention, problem-solving, and critical thinking, empowers children to grasp complex concepts later in their educational journey. Engaging activities like puzzles, reading, and play enhance these skills, fostering creativity and adaptability. Moreover, developing a growth mindset during these years teaches children resilience and the understanding that effort leads to improvement.

Supporting cognitive development also promotes effective communication and collaboration skills, essential in navigating social settings. When children face cognitive challenges, they need guidance to overcome them, building confidence and self-esteem.

In short, parents and teachers play a vital role in nurturing these skills, helping children embark on a journey toward academic achievement and personal growth. Investing in cognitive development during these crucial years lays the groundwork for a successful and fulfilling future, helping children navigate the complexities of life and learning.
